How Long Do Homes Typically Stay on the Market in Roanoke?

by Walter Grewe

   

If you're thinking about buying or selling in the Roanoke Valley, one of the most common questions you may have is: How long do homes typically stay on the market right now? The answer offers helpful insight into the pace and balance of the market.

Over the past few years, Roanoke experienced an unusually fast-moving market, with many homes going under contract in just a few days. While some properties still move quickly, the pace has returned to something more sustainable. Today, most homes in Roanoke City, Roanoke County, Salem, Botetourt, and surrounding areas stay on the market for a few weeks on average, depending heavily on price point, condition, and location.

Homes in popular neighborhoods like Grandin, Raleigh Court, and Cave Spring may still attract faster activity—especially if they’re updated and priced correctly. Meanwhile, homes that need work, sit at higher price points, or are located farther from amenities may take longer, sometimes several weeks or more. This is perfectly normal for a balanced market.

One thing hasn’t changed: presentation matters. Homes that are clean, well‑staged, and priced accurately based on recent comparable sales consistently draw more showings and more timely offers. Even in a slower market, buyers respond to move‑in‑ready homes.

Another important factor is seasonality. Spring and early summer traditionally bring more buyers, which can lead to faster sales. Fall and winter often see fewer listings and fewer showings, but serious buyers still shop year‑round—especially those relocating, downsizing, or timing a purchase around life changes.

For sellers, understanding realistic expectations is key. A home that doesn’t sell in 48 hours isn’t a problem—it’s simply part of the market’s natural rhythm. For buyers, a slightly slower pace can be a major advantage, giving you more time to evaluate options, conduct inspections, and make confident decisions.
